Understanding Verified Buyer Badges

Verified badges prove that reviews come from customers who actually purchased the product through your store.

Verified Reviews

From actual purchasers
  • Customer ordered product through your store
  • Order confirmed in WooCommerce/Shopify
  • Purchase tied to review in Yuko database
  • Automatic or manual verification available
  • Displays “Verified Buyer” or “Verified Purchase” badge
Trust level: High - shoppers trust these 3-5x more

Unverified Reviews

No purchase record found
  • Review submitted without order connection
  • Customer may have purchased in-store or elsewhere
  • Imported reviews without order data
  • Manual review submissions
  • No badge displayed (or “Unverified” label optional)
Trust level: Lower - shoppers often question authenticity
Automatic verification: When connected to WooCommerce or Shopify, Yuko automatically verifies reviews from customers who purchased through your online store.
How Verified Badges Work:

Yuko Dashboard → Settings → Reviews → Manage Reviews -> Add Verified Badge
vb.png

A review earns a Verified Buyer badge when:
  • The reviewer purchased the product from your connected Shopify or WooCommerce store
  • The review is successfully matched to a real order in Yuko
  • The purchase data (email, order ID, product) aligns with the review
Once enabled, Yuko automatically applies the Verified Buyer badge to all qualifying reviews.

Reviewer Name Format

  • Choose how reviewer names appear publicly on all widgets.
    Options include:
    • Full Name – Ideal for transparency and trust
    • First Name Only – A balance of privacy and authenticity
    • Initials – Best for privacy-focused stores
    Use this when you want to match your store’s privacy and branding guidelines.s
Settings: Yuko Dashboard → Settings → Reviews → Display → Reviewer Name Format
Legal note: Some regions (EU with GDPR) may require explicit customer consent to display full names. Check local privacy laws.
